In Episode 6 of the Naughty By Nature podcast, our host, Treen, unpacks the complexities of feminine identity within Christianity alongside Christina Tasooji, a women’s leadership coach and writer.
Together, they discuss the limiting religious stories that shaped their views of women and explore how the absence of feminine representation in the church impacted their development and confidence.
This episode features Shahbano Farid, who plays God, bringing a fresh perspective on how women are regarded in Islam. Her insights serve as a powerful balm for both Treen and Christina. Together, they dig into the importance of reclaiming influential female figures like Mary Magdalene and Lilith who challenge the traditional narratives that have long oppressed the feminine.
Christina reflects on her journey to reconnect with the divine feminine, highlighting how embracing her body's rhythms and wisdom played a vital role in her spiritual awakening. They both emphasize the revolutionary potential of the divine feminine as a source of life and creation, advocating for a spiritual landscape where both masculine and feminine energies can coexist and thrive.
Filled with humor, vulnerability, and lasting spiritual insights, this episode invites you to reexamine your perceptions of femininity, identity, and spirituality. It’s a heartfelt call to embrace the wholeness of the divine, reclaim and perhaps change the narrative you grew up with, and to honor the sacredness of both the masculine and feminine within us all!

Born Again, Again: Life After Christianity
In this vibrant (and final - at least for now) episode of the Naughty By Nature podcast, Treen talks about reclaiming spirituality after leaving Evangelicalism. Joined by Spiritual Director and Somatic Practitioner Hailey Mitsui, they engage in an honest conversation about how their relationship with the Christian faith evolved.
They reflect on what was comfortable and safe about Evangelicalism and what parts of themselves they had to suppress in order to belong. Actor and comedian Jordan Hull, plays God, and taps into themes of polyamory, sharing how embracing one's true identity can lead to spiritual freedom.
Hailey discusses how the Indigenous wisdom tradition of Christianity was co-opted by empire, and shares her intention to try and heal the harm it has done. Together, the three of them explore the duality of grief and liberation that accompanies spiritual development and the need to foster communities that acknowledge and embrace the whole person.
With laughter, vulnerability, and a spirit of curiosity, Episode 7 invites us to reexamine our beliefs, especially the Christian ones. Treen and Hailey emphasize the importance of integrating all aspects of the self in a journey toward wholeness.
